A stacked telescopic image showing the International Space Station as a bright streak passing close to Saturn in the night sky. Saturn appears small but clear, with its rings nearly edge-on. The ISS looks larger and brighter due to its proximity to Earth. Both objects are framed against a dark background. The image captures their brief alignment as seen from Federal Way, Washington, on July 6, 2025.

Infrared image of Centaurus A, the closest active galaxy to Earth, showing a twisted parallelogram-shaped dust cloud, likely the result of a smaller galaxy merging with it.  The image was captured by the Spitzer Space Telescope.  The dust cloud is about 1000 light-years across and provides fuel for the supermassive black hole at the galaxy's center.

False-color infrared image of the Rho Ophiuchi cloud complex, a nearby star-forming region approximately 400 light-years away.  The image, captured by WISE, reveals young stars (YSOs) embedded in pinkish nebulae and a reflection nebula near Sigma Scorpii.  The vibrant colors highlight the infrared glow of dust heated by newborn stars, showcasing the beauty and complexity of stellar birth.

A stunning infrared image of the W5 star-forming region (also known as IC 1848), part of the Heart and Soul Nebulas in Cassiopeia.  The image shows massive stars at the center triggering the formation of younger stars at the edges, with pillars of gas slowly evaporating.  This image was captured by NASA's WISE satellite and spans approximately 2,000 light-years.

A stunning mosaic image from NASA's Voyager 1 spacecraft shows Jupiter's swirling cloud bands with its moon Io.  Taken in 1979 from 8.3 million kilometers, this image reveals Io's volcanic features, initially mistaken for impact craters.  The image highlights the contrast between Jupiter's dynamic atmosphere and Io's unique, volcanically active surface.

Stunning image of NGC 4651, the "Umbrella Galaxy," showcasing a tidal stream of stars resembling a cosmic umbrella. This stellar structure, approximately 100,000 light-years across, is the result of a smaller galaxy's disintegration during repeated encounters with NGC 4651. Captured by the Canada-France-Hawaii Telescope (CFHT).

Infrared image of galactic dust clouds in the Cygnus region of the Milky Way. The dust is arranged in a foam-like structure with bubbles and voids, likely formed by stellar winds and supernovae shocks.  The image reveals bright, bubble-shaped, and arc-like clouds around supernova remnants and star-forming regions.  Data from NASA's IRAS satellite.

A crescent-shaped Neptune and its moon Triton, captured by Voyager 2 in 1989.  The image, taken from a unique vantage point, shows Neptune's reddish hue due to forward-scattered sunlight, a view impossible from Earth.  Triton is visible as a small, bright point of light near Neptune.

A dramatic black and white image of asteroid 433 Eros, taken by the NEAR Shoemaker spacecraft from an altitude of approximately 50 kilometers. The image showcases the asteroid's rugged surface, littered with boulders, with the largest one, roughly 30 meters across, situated near a shadowy crater.  The sun's rays illuminate the scene, creating striking contrasts and shadows. This near-Earth asteroid's journey from the main asteroid belt highlights the gravitational forces shaping our solar system.
